Dean Lockwood has been in and out of University of Tennessee athletics for more than 20 years. A member of Don DeVoe’s basketball staffs in the late 1980s, he returned to a few years ago as a key assistant for Pat Summitt’s Lady Vols.
So he’s experienced more than a few highs and lows in Volsville. In town for Tuesday’s Big Orange Caravan stop at the Choo-Choo, Lockwood said, “I don’t know that I’ve ever seen this level of excitement for all three sports at once.”
Those three sports, of course, are football, men’s basketball and women’s basketball, basically the wholly trinity of UT athletics’ money-making machine.
